UPDATE: Three Boys Identified In Federalsburg Drowning Accident

FEDERALSBURG, Md. - Three boys have drowned in a creek in Federalsburg, MD according to officials.

They say that 12-year-old Vladimir Petron Jacotin, his 11-year-old cousin, Christopher Toto Gabriel, and six-year-old Yamoude Dona were reported missing at 1:30AM on Sunday.  They were last seen playing in the parking lot of the First Church of God on Bloomingdale Avenue at Old Denton Road around 5PM on Saturday.

A preliminary search was made Saturday night, but nothing was found. When the boys did not return home the next morning, a more serious search was initiated. Crews from the Federalsburg Police Department, Caroline County Sheriff's Department, the Maryland State Police, and Maryland Natural Resources; as well as personnel from Emergency Medical Services, Federalsburg Volunteer Fire Company, surrounding fire companies and Delmarva Search and Rescue volunteers and dogs conducted the search.

They found the body of the 12-year-old at 10AM Sunday morning in Marshyhope Creek behind a cluster of homes in the 100 block of Old Denton Road. The body of the 6-year-old was found 30 minutes later. The third body was located by the Mid-shore Dive Team about 20 feet from where the first body was found around 1:30PM.

Authorities say they are not speculating foul play and are calling this an accidental drowning - the coroner arrived at the scene and it appeared that the bodies were in good shape - they will be sent to Baltimore for an autopsy.

Marshyhope Creek is a part of the Nanticoke River and is said to be about 8 feet deep.

The investigation will be continued under the jurisdiction of the Natural Resources Police.
